I think a button for "pass" would be useful. Currently there's no way to pass and problems have to do hack solutions like "play at A (dame) to pass if you think there is no more endgame around here".

On a related note, buttons called "tenuki" and "ko threat" would also be useful for problems that aren't whole-board. There are many problems that have "live or play T if you think you can't", "can you kill? If not, play at T to tenuki", "play at K if you need to play a ko threat" etc... They could be represented in the SGF as labelled squares "kothreat" and "tenuki" or something, a bit away from the problem itself (and not shown when the problem is presented, of course).

The main attraction of these added facilities (apart from the elegance) would be that less problems require instructions in English (and non-translateable since it's in the SGFs themselves), and thus make the site more attractive internationally.

And surely, the above system could be generalized to automatically adding buttons for intersections (not shown) with labels beginning with some fixed string. It would be a much more elegant way to handle all those "what's the status of this group?" "how many points was the marked move worth?" etc. problems, but then one'd lose some of the translation aspect. Possibly have a fixed set of labels/buttons available.
